underscore.js 相关问题

Underscore是一个用于JavaScript的实用程序带库,它提供了许多您在Prototype.js(或Ruby)中所期望的函数式编程支持,但没有扩展任何内置的JavaScript对象。与jQuery的礼服搭配是很好的结合。

根据文件顺序列表对骨干集合进行排序

我继承了一个系统,该系统利用需要根据一系列值进行排序的文件的 Backbone 集合。当您将不同的文件滑入某个位置时,顺序变量将被保存...

回答 1 投票 0

Underscore.js - 如何识别 JavaScript 依赖项?

我正在为我的移动应用程序项目使用backbone.js 和underscore.js。我的问题是如何识别每个文件的 JavaScript 依赖关系?我尝试使用下面的代码,但仍然无法在我的眉毛中工作......

回答 1 投票 0

阅读了无数的骨干教程,但仍然遗漏了一些东西

我在 StackExchange 上阅读了无数的帖子以及互联网上无数的教程,但我似乎还没有了解基本的 Backbone 使用和实现。 我正在尝试...

回答 1 投票 0

如何创建记忆功能

我被这个记忆问题难住了。我需要创建一个函数来检查是否已经为给定参数计算了值、返回之前的结果或运行计算...

回答 6 投票 0

下划线的each和ES5 forEach的区别

我有 _.each(this.fields, 函数(field, idx) { 我想我可以把它改成 this.fields.forEach(函数(字段, idx) { 没有破坏任何东西。 之间真的有区别吗

回答 2 投票 0

从ggplot2箱线图中删除下划线

我想从我的ggplot2箱线图中删除下划线(填充“fungicide_treatment”的标题。我已经尝试更改我的excel数据文件中的列标题,并且我已经尝试过...

回答 1 投票 0

使用lodash .groupBy。如何添加自己的键以进行分组输出?

我有从 API 返回的示例数据。 我正在使用 Lodash 的 _.groupBy 将数据转换为我可以更好使用的对象。 返回的原始数据是这样的: [ { “姓名”:“吉姆”, ...

回答 12 投票 0

JS 日期数组如何按天分组

我正在尝试找出最优化且循环次数最少的方法来对我的 js 日期对象数组进行分组:(请注意,这是浏览器控制台输出,它实际上是真正的 JS d...

回答 5 投票 0

从对象中删除空对象

我正在尝试删除对象内的空对象,这是一个具有预期输出的示例: var 对象 = { A: { 乙:1, C: { 答:1, d:{}, ...

回答 4 投票 0

根据偶数/奇数索引将数组转换为对象

我试图根据数组的索引是奇数还是偶数将数组转换为对象。 例如,, 输入: [“姓名”,“汤姆”,“年龄”,20] 输出:{“姓名”:“汤姆”,“年龄”:20 } 可以是

回答 7 投票 0

Arguments 对象不适用于下划线第一类型函数

作为练习,我必须重现 Underscore.js 库中的第一个函数。 我编写的代码通过了所有测试,除了“应该在参数对象上工作”之外。 我通过了这些...

回答 1 投票 0

如何从 Javascript 中的对象中选择属性

我有以下目标: {“id”:“kl45wkfj1k4j34”,“名字”:“阿伦”,“姓氏”:“K”} 我有要过滤的键,使用逗号分隔符在字符串中分配“名字,姓氏”。 ...

回答 10 投票 0

获取对象中的下一个键值对

给定一个键,我想找到对象中的下一个属性。我不能依赖键来排序或顺序(它们是 uuid)。请参阅下面的简单示例,了解我想要的内容: var db = { ...

回答 6 投票 0

如何从数组中返回对象? [重复]

我有一个对象数组,我想搜索每个对象并检查数据是否与给定值匹配,我想从数组中返回该对象,如果找不到,那么我...

回答 3 投票 0

Underscore debounce vs vanilla Javascript setTimeout

我知道 Undercore.js 中的 debounce 返回一个函数,该函数将推迟其执行,直到等待时间结束。 我的问题是,使用去抖比常规的有优势吗

回答 5 投票 0

错误类型 DeepTypeOfCollection 不是通用的

运行 NG BUILD 时,我收到错误:类型 DeepTypeOfCollection 不是通用的。另外,类型别名 DeepTypeOfCollection 循环引用自身。

回答 1 投票 0

根据属性将对象数组分解为单独的数组

假设我有一个像这样的数组: var arr = [ {类型:“橙色”,标题:“第一”}, {类型:“橙色”,标题:“第二个”}, {type:"香蕉", title:"第三个"}, {type:"香蕉", title:"第四"} ]; 和...

回答 12 投票 0

如何从单个数组创建数组集合?

假设我有一个大数组,例如 [1、2、3、4、5、6、7、8、9、10、11、12、13、14、15、16、17、18] 并想将其分成 n 元组数组,例如 [[1,2]、[3,4]、[5,6]、[7,8]、[9,10]、[11...

回答 5 投票 0

在 JavaScript 中仅将唯一对象添加到数组中

假设我从这个开始: var 运输地址 = [ { “名字”:“凯文”, "lastname": "边界", “地址1”:“2201N

回答 7 投票 0

下划线从头开始记忆

在研究下划线记忆时,我不明白这一行: var argString = Array.prototype.join.call(arguments,"_");。我知道它正在创建一个参数字符串,但是它是如何...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.